World Series managers in 1981 were Tommy Lasorda of the Los Angeles Dodgers, and Bob Lemon of the New York Yankees. In 1988 it was Lasorda and the Dodgers again, against Tony La Russa of the Oakland Athletics. Lasorda and the Dodgers won both series.

The Los Angeles Dodgers were managed by Tom Lasorda in 1981 when they won the World Series. Under his leadership, the team clinched the championship by defeating the New York Yankees in six games. This victory marked the Dodgers' first World Series title since 1965. Lasorda's managerial skills and motivational style were pivotal to the team's success that season.
